Akin Park, Evansville, IN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Akin Park?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Akin Park 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$984 | $795 | $1,495 |
Akin Park 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,228 | $850 | $1,600 |
Akin Park 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,000 | $1,000 | $1,000 |
Akin Park 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,245 | $1,195 | $1,295 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Akin Park
What type of rentals are currently available in Akin Park?
There are currently 175 Apartments for Rent in Akin Park, IN with pricing that ranges from $625 to $2,514. There are also 42 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Akin Park ranging from $575 to $2,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Akin Park?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Akin Park ranges from $575 to $2,500 with an average monthly rent of $1,092.
